Output 55ddda18c30794abd22c6274338a23a4e1f8bd362f75da9bb87c8c018b574d88:10

value
38056964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ac75cae3403c6a33c1bd3b5c8d4516ea4c56e0db OP_EQUAL
address
MPd3ZnyZLgQR8nxrzpE7SNVbEZcy5AboKE
transaction
55ddda18c30794abd22c6274338a23a4e1f8bd362f75da9bb87c8c018b574d88
spent
true